A beautifully presented three Bedroom Semi-Detached home in a sought-after Caernarfon location, offering stylish and spacious accommodation, a newly fitted Kitchen/Diner, landscaped garden, off-road parking, solar panels with battery storage, and excellent views towards Eryri (Snowdonia) Mountain range.
Situated in a highly sought-after residential neighbourhood in the Gwel Y Llan estate, this beautifully presented three Bedroom Semi-Detached home offers contemporary and well-proportioned accommodation throughout. The property features a newly fitted Kitchen/Diner with double patio doors, ground-floor W/C and first-floor family Bathroom, a well-maintained rear garden with patio and decking, and off-road parking to the front. Located in the historic town of Caernarfon, the property is within walking distance of Ysgol Yr Hendre Primary School, with a wide range of additional amenities available in the town centre. The accommodation begins with a wide and welcoming Entrance Hall, featuring stairs to the first floor, easy-care vinyl click flooring and a convenient WC with fitted storage cupboards situated at the far end. To the front of the property is a generous Lounge, benefiting from a feature media wall with an inset electric fireplace providing both warmth and ambience. Bespoke shelving sits to the side, while a carpet provides added comfort. To the rear is the impressive Kitchen/Diner, complete with a newly fitted kitchen featuring contemporary grey cabinetry and contrasting off-white worktops. Integrated appliances include a ceramic hob, oven, microwave/oven, pull-out cooker hood, 70/30 fridge/freezer, dishwasher and pull-out bin. A custom-built dining table with painted cabinetry and a solid wood worktop provides additional preparation space as well as an ideal area for dining and entertaining. A rear-facing window and double patio doors overlook and provide direct access to the garden, creating a seamless connection between the indoor and outdoor spaces. Upstairs, the Landing provides access to the loft space, which benefits from a pull-down ladder and lighting. There are three well-proportioned Bedrooms, with the principal bedroom enjoying a rear-facing window overlooking the garden and offering views towards the Eryri (Snowdonia) mountain range in the distance. Bedrooms 2 and 3 are positioned to the front of the property. Completing the first-floor accommodation is the family Bathroom, fitted with a shower over the bath, contemporary black fittings, W/C, washbasin and heated towel rail. The room features partially tiled walls and matching LVT flooring. A useful cupboard in the bathroom is currently utilised as a utility space and benefits from plumbing for a washing machine and a fitted worktop. Outside, the enclosed rear garden has been thoughtfully maintained and landscaped, comprising a paved patio area, a wooden deck leading onto a lawn with sleeper borders and decorative golden gravel. The garden provides a versatile space for outdoor dining, entertaining and relaxation. To the front, a brick-paved driveway provides off-road parking for two vehicles complete with an EV charger included in the sale, with a small lawned area to the side. A pathway leads to a gate and private alleyway providing access to the rear garden, offering a convenient and discreet area for bin storage. The property further benefits from gas central heating, uPVC double glazing throughout and an impressive 3.6kW solar PV system comprising eight panels, together with a 5.76kW battery storage system.
